Anne W. Rea is a scholar working on Health, Toxicology and Mutagenesis, Global and Planetary Change and Pollution. According to data from OpenAlex, Anne W. Rea has authored 25 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Health, Toxicology and Mutagenesis, 8 papers in Global and Planetary Change and 6 papers in Pollution. Recurrent topics in Anne W. Rea’s work include Air Quality and Health Impacts (7 papers), Land Use and Ecosystem Services (6 papers) and Environmental Conservation and Management (6 papers). Anne W. Rea is often cited by papers focused on Air Quality and Health Impacts (7 papers), Land Use and Ecosystem Services (6 papers) and Environmental Conservation and Management (6 papers). Anne W. Rea collaborates with scholars based in United States, United Kingdom and France. Anne W. Rea's co-authors include Gerald J. Keeler, Steven E. Lindbeŕg, T. Scherbatskoy, Ron Williams, Linda Sheldon, Charles Rodes, Wayne R. Munns, Carry Croghan, Alan Vette and Lance Wallace and has published in prestigious journals such as Environmental Science & Technology, The Science of The Total Environment and Atmospheric Environment.
